当前位置:首页>AI提示库 >

图片转提示词工具的API接口开发与集成方案

发布时间:2025-07-24源自:融质(上海)科技有限公司作者:融质科技编辑部

图片转提示词工具的API接口开发与集成方案

随着人工智能技术的不断发展,图像识别和自然语言处理已经成为了当今科技领域的热门话题。其中,将图片转化为文本的技术,即“图片转提示词”功能,不仅在教育领域有着广泛的应用,也在许多其他场景中发挥着重要作用。本文将详细介绍如何开发一个高效、可靠的图片转提示词工具的API接口,以及如何将其集成到现有的系统中。

一、理解需求

我们需要明确开发这个API接口的目的。一般来说,这个接口的主要作用是将用户上传的图片转换为对应的文字描述。例如,在一个在线教育平台上,学生可以上传一张图片,系统通过API接口识别出图片中的物体或场景,然后生成一段描述文字,帮助学生更好地理解和记忆课程内容。

二、技术选型

选择适合的技术栈对于开发这个API接口至关重要。目前,Python语言因其简洁易读、丰富的库支持以及强大的网络通信能力而成为首选。我们可以使用TensorFlow、PyTorch等深度学习框架进行图像识别任务,同时利用Flask或Django等Web框架来构建API接口。此外,我们还可以使用Elasticsearch等搜索引擎来提高查询效率。

三、功能设计

在功能设计方面,我们需要考虑以下几个关键因素:

  1. 图像上传:用户可以通过Web界面或API接口上传图片。为了确保安全性,我们应实现文件的加密传输和验证机制。
  2. 图像识别:采用深度学习模型对上传的图片进行识别,提取关键特征点,并生成描述文字。
  3. 结果输出:将识别结果以结构化的形式返回给用户,如JSON格式。
  4. 错误处理:对于识别失败的图片,应提供相应的错误信息和建议。
  5. 性能优化:考虑到用户体验,我们应优化API接口的性能,确保响应速度和稳定性。

四、集成方案

将上述功能整合到一个统一的API接口中,需要遵循以下步骤:

  1. 搭建后端服务:使用Python语言编写后端服务,实现图像识别和结果输出的功能。
  2. 配置前端展示:根据用户需求,设计前端页面或API接口,方便用户上传图片和查看结果。
  3. 数据存储:将识别结果存储在数据库中,以便后续检索和使用。
  4. 安全防护:实施必要的安全措施,如访问控制、数据加密等,确保系统的安全性。

五、测试与优化

在开发过程中,我们需要不断地进行测试和优化,以确保API接口的稳定性和准确性。这包括单元测试、集成测试和压力测试等。同时,我们还需要关注用户的反馈,不断改进产品,提升用户体验。

开发一个高效的图片转提示词工具的API接口需要综合考虑技术选型、功能设计、集成方案等多个方面。通过遵循上述步骤,我们可以开发出一个既稳定又易于使用的API接口,为用户带来更好的体验。

欢迎分享转载→ https://shrzkj.com.cn/aiprompts/104885.html

Copyright © 2025 融质(上海)科技有限公司 All Rights Reserved. 本站部分资源来自互联网收集,如有侵权请联系我们删除。沪ICP备2024065424号-2XML地图